TERRITORY OF DARFUR SURRENDERED TO MAHDITES.
(Received May 28, 1.20 p.m.) LONDON. May 27. In the House of Lords to-day Earl Granville, replying to a question, stated that parleying between England and France in connection with the projected European Conference was still proceeding, and the Government would inform Parliament of the result of the exchange of views before the meeting of the convention.
